What Is the 1078838 Galvanized Coil?
The 1078838 Galvanized Coil refers to a specific product code used by steel manufacturers. It indicates a galvanized steel coil with particular zinc coating and thickness parameters. These coils are coated with zinc to prevent rust, making them ideal for outdoor applications.
Why Are Zinc Coating & Thickness Important?
The zinc coating provides corrosion resistance, while the coil’s thickness influences durability and formability. Selecting the right specs ensures your project withstands environmental challenges.

2. Understanding the 1078838 Galvanized Coil Specs
Key Technical Data
The 1078838 Galvanized Coil Specs generally include:
- Zinc Coating Weight: Ranges from 100 to 275 g/m²
- Thickness: Typically between 0.12mm and 2.0mm
- Coil Width: 600mm to 1500mm
- Surface Finish: Matte or glossy options
- Tensile Strength: 270-550 MPa
Why These Specs Matter
The zinc coating weight directly impacts corrosion resistance, while the thickness affects strength and flexibility. Matching these specs with your application guarantees longevity.

Practical Checklist for Buying Galvanized Coils
- Confirm zinc coating weight matches project needs.
- Verify coil thickness and surface finish.
- Check supplier certifications and quality reports.
- Request samples for testing.
- Compare prices and lead times.
- Review supplier reputation thoroughly.
- Clarify delivery and payment terms.
- Confirm after-sales support.
- Ensure proper packaging.
- Keep all documentation for future reference.
